Product Description
Turkey & Chicken Formula Dry Cat and Kitten Food EVO Cat and Kitten Food was created to supply the key nutritional benefits of a raw food diet in a safe and convenient manner. EVO can be fed exclusively as a total diet for your pet or in combination with a raw diet to provide a solid nutritional base of the important vitamins and minerals your feline might otherwise be missing.     I don’t mean to imply by my one star rating that it isn’t a great product. I just wanted to point out that it’s not for every cat. One of my cats did fine on this food, and the other had very bad diarrhea for over a week until I switched to another food. My vet said that this was not uncommon and that, like people, all digestive tracts are made differently. If your cat has a problem on this food for more than a couple of days, it’s probably best try another.

    I used to feed Wellness because not a lot of places sold Evo. But before I moved to the US I fed them Evo whenever I could afford it (trial pack for $20+). So as soon as I found out where to get Evo, I drove downtown and to my surprise, it was even cheaper than Wellness!! I also feed stray cats and I found it to be cheaper to feed them Evo too. Although it costs alot for a bag but you feed less, and so it lasts long.

    5lbs of Wellness lasts for at most 3 weeks- $20

    6lbs of Evo lasts for 1 month 2 weeks- $19

    You do the math!
